Logiciel de traitement d’images : outils et techniques (2024)

Comment les systèmes de vision industrielle traitent-ils les images qu’ils capturent?

Lorsque la bonne combinaison de capteur, de lentille, d’éclairage et d’autres composants est en place, un système de vision industrielle est prêt à acquérir des images. Mais ce n’est que la première étape.

Une fois qu’il a acquis une image, le système doit traiter et analyser le résultat pour prendre une décision: lire un code-barres, détecter un défaut, confirmer qu’un kit contient tous les éléments nécessaires ou mesurer une pièce.

Historiquement, la seule façon d’obtenir une puissance de traitement suffisante pour effectuer l’analyse d’image était d’envoyer l’image vers un PC externe. Selon la taille et la complexité de l’image, cette tâche pouvait prendre du temps, ce qui ralentissait potentiellement la ligne et nécessitait un PC séparé dédié.

Aujourd’hui, les systèmes de vision hautement performants disposent d’un traitement embarqué, ce qui accélère le calcul et réduit les points de défaillance possibles.

Logiciel de traitement d’images: outils et techniques (1)

Une fois qu’il a acquis une image, le système doit traiter et analyser le résultat pour prendre une décision: lire un code-barres, détecter un défaut, confirmer qu’un kit contient tous les éléments nécessaires ou mesurer une pièce.

Les types d’outils d’analyse d’images

Selon la tâche, un système de vision peut tirer parti d’un ou plusieurs outils d’analyse d’images spécifiques.

Logiciel de traitement d’images: outils et techniques (2)

Détection/Extraction des bords

Dans une image, un bord marque un changement distinct d’intensité. Ces changements marquent les discontinuités de profondeur, d’orientation et de matériau, et permettent de trouver le contour des objets.

Logiciel de traitement d’images: outils et techniques (3)

Comptage des pixels

Un algorithme simple peut compter le nombre de pixels à chaque niveau de gris dans une région d’intérêt ou dans toute l’image, et fournir des informations utilisées par d’autres fonctions.

Logiciel de traitement d’images: outils et techniques (4)

Détection de blobs

Différentes régions peuvent être identifiées, fournissant des informations utilisées par d’autres fonctions.

Logiciel de traitement d’images: outils et techniques (5)

Correspondance forme/modèle

Les fonctions de guidage et de positionnement utilisent la reconnaissance géométrique ou la reconnaissance de modèle sur les pièces et les produits pour déterminer l’emplacement et l’orientation de l’objet.

Logiciel de traitement d’images: outils et techniques (6)

Analyse des couleurs

Lorsque la couleur de l’objet est une caractéristique importante, il existe plusieurs outils, notamment l’extraction et la segmentation des couleurs ainsi que la correspondance des couleurs.

Utiliser les informations issues des images

Les informations dérivées de cette analyse d’image ne servent pas à grand-chose si elles restent dans la caméra. Elles doivent être partagées avec d’autres systèmes qui peuvent s’en servir.

Pour ce faire, les systèmes de vision industrielle utilisent des formats ou protocoles industriels standards pour partager des données avec d’autres appareils, généralement par connexion filaire. Ces données peuvent ensuite être utilisées de plusieurs façons:

Logiciel de traitement d’images: outils et techniques (7)

Elles peuvent indiquer à un automate programmable industriel (API) à proximité de déclencher un piston pour exclure les pièces défectueuses de la ligne.

Logiciel de traitement d’images: outils et techniques (8)

Elles peuvent s’afficher sur un écran d’interface homme-machine (IHM) afin qu’un opérateur puisse vérifier un processus de production et effectuer des ajustements.

Logiciel de traitement d’images: outils et techniques (9)

Elles peuvent être utilisées avec le système de contrôle de production de l’usine ou un système d’exécution de la fabrication (manufacturing execution system, MES), afin que le système puisse effectuer des ajustements pour optimiser le processus de fabrication.

Logiciel de traitement d’images: outils et techniques (10)

Elles peuvent déclencher des mécanismes de tri dans un système de tri automatisé pour placer un colis dans le bon camion.

Les données extraites d’images servent également à prendre des décisions plus importantes.

Outre les actions individuelles sur des pièces, produits ou emballages individuels, les données générées par les applications de vision industrielle peuvent également être agrégées et utilisées pour résoudre des problèmes commerciaux plus importants.

Par exemple, les entreprises peuvent utiliser les données pour trouver les causes profondes des retards, des défauts et des expéditions manquées. Un fournisseur utilise-t-il des matières premières de qualité inférieure? Ou le problème est-il causé par la façon dont les pièces sont stockées ou expédiées? La formation des ouvriers est-elle inadaptée? Les données de vision industrielle peuvent être analysées pour identifier la source du problème.

Les données de vision industrielle peuvent aussi être utilisées, par exemple, dans les applications suivantes:

Logiciel de traitement d’images: outils et techniques (11)

Apprendre qu’un certain type de pièce provoque le rejet des assemblages dans lesquels elle est installée

Logiciel de traitement d’images: outils et techniques (12)

Localiser et identifier des pièces, mettre à jour l’inventaire en continu et garantir un traitement précis des commandes

Logiciel de traitement d’images: outils et techniques (13)

Analyser de grands ensembles de données avec un progiciel de gestion intégré (Enterprise Resource Planning, ERP) pour prendre des décisions opérationnelles à long terme

Logiciel de traitement d’images: outils et techniques (14)

Examiner les taux et les types d’échec pour identifier les erreurs de production introduites

Les types de protocoles de communication

Il existe un large éventail de protocoles utilisés dans la fabrication automatisée, des signaux marche/arrêt simples envoyés par une connexion directe aux protocoles industriels sophistiqués tels qu’Ethernet/IP, Profibus et DeviceNet, entre autres.

Bien que le meilleur appareil pour une tâche spécifique soit généralement interopérable, c’est-à-dire qu’il peut communiquer avec tous vos équipements actuels, certains fabricants peuvent privilégier un protocole ou un autre, et il existe de nombreuses normes propriétaires.

Les systèmes de vision industrielle peuvent être configurés pour être interopérables avec pratiquement n’importe quel ensemble de protocoles industriels, fournissant leurs informations sous une forme qui est facilement utilisée pour améliorer les opérations industrielles automatisées.

Logiciel de traitement d’images: outils et techniques (15)

Retour au début

Présentation de la vision industrielle

Table des matières

  • Présentation de la vision industrielle
  • Les types de vision industrielle et leurs capacités
  • Vision industrielle basée sur des règles vs sur l’IA
  • Les composants matériels de la vision industrielle
  • L’importance de l’éclairage dans les applications de vision industrielle
  • Les logiciels d’analyse d’images

Logiciel de traitement d’images: outils et techniques (16)

Télécharger le livre blanc

mail_outline Contacter le service commercial

pricing Obtenir les tarifs

settings Demander une démonstration produit

Logiciel de traitement d’images : outils et techniques (2024)

References

Top Articles
Latest Posts
Article information

Author: Msgr. Benton Quitzon

Last Updated:

Views: 6085

Rating: 4.2 / 5 (63 voted)

Reviews: 94% of readers found this page helpful

Author information

Name: Msgr. Benton Quitzon

Birthday: 2001-08-13

Address: 96487 Kris Cliff, Teresiafurt, WI 95201

Phone: +9418513585781

Job: Senior Designer

Hobby: Calligraphy, Rowing, Vacation, Geocaching, Web surfing, Electronics, Electronics

Introduction: My name is Msgr. Benton Quitzon, I am a comfortable, charming, thankful, happy, adventurous, handsome, precious person who loves writing and wants to share my knowledge and understanding with you.